Abstract
Toe die studiedeputate wat deur die Nasionale Sinode van die Gereformeerde Kerk in Suid-Afrika in 1967 benoem is in verband met art. 36 van die Nederlandse Geloofsbelydenis, aan die werk gespring het, het dit nodig geblyk om eers ’n volledige beeld van die historiese agtergrond van die saak te kry. Die materiaal wat hierby versamel is, het uiteindelik soveel geword, dat net die nodigste kerngeinkorporeer kon word in die verslag aan die Sinode van 1970.
